The perimeter of a rectangular field is 60 m.
What are three possible measurements
of the field? Use dimensions to the
nearest meter.

Answer:

10m by 20m

12 m by 18 m

14m by 16m

Step-by-step explanation:

The perimeter of a rectangle is

P = 2(l+w)

60 = 2(l+w)

Divide each side by 2

30 = l+w

Let l = 10

Then w = 30 - 10 = 20

Let l = 12  then w = 30 - 12 = 18

Let l = 14  then w = 30 -14 = 16
